Definition and Explanation of Evictions

In California, evictions are civil actions to regain possession of a rental unit when lawful grounds exist, such as nonpayment, lease violations, or end of tenancy.

Key Elements and Processes in an Eviction Case

Key elements include proper notices, service, a filed complaint, possible defenses, court hearings, and enforcement steps if judgment is issued.

Key Terms and Glossary

Glossary of terms commonly used in eviction cases.

Notice to Quit

A formal written notice informing the tenant of a tenancy issue and the remedy or move-out deadline.

Unlawful Detainer

The legal action filed to regain possession after the notice period ends.

Writ of Possession

A court order directing the sheriff to remove a tenant and return possession to the landlord.

Lease Agreement

The contract outlining tenancy terms, including rent, duration, and rules.

What is the eviction process in California?

Typically the eviction process starts with a properly served notice, followed by an unlawful detainer complaint if the tenant does not cure or vacate. The timeline can vary based on the reason for eviction and the court’s schedule. Working with an eviction attorney helps ensure notices are proper, deadlines are met, and court filings are accurate.

In Port Hueneme, timelines are influenced by state and local rules as well as court availability. While some cases move quickly, others may require careful preparation and possible negotiations. A lawyer can help you anticipate steps and plan accordingly.

Both landlords and tenants may initiate eviction actions under California law, provided there is a lawful basis and proper procedure. Tenants often have defenses based on illegal rent increases, improper notices, or retaliatory actions. A lawyer helps evaluate options and defenses.

Tenant defenses can include improper service, defective notices, breach of warranty of habitability, or failure to follow rent control or shelter laws. Understanding these defenses early can influence strategy and outcomes.

Eviction litigation costs vary with complexity, court fees, and whether litigation is necessary. Many cases are resolved through negotiation or settlement, which can reduce overall expenses.

Service by mail is sometimes allowed for certain notices, but many steps require personal service or alternate methods under the California Code. An attorney ensures service compliance to avoid delays.

A writ of possession is a court order that authorizes law enforcement to remove a tenant and restore possession to the landlord after a judgment. Enforcement steps must follow strict legal procedures.

Mediation can be a practical way to resolve eviction disputes without a court trial. It often leads to faster, mutually agreeable outcomes and can preserve landlord-tenant relationships.

Landlords should prepare accurate lease documents, payment histories, notices, and any communications with the tenant. Being organized helps the case move more smoothly through the court process.
